NCGA Urges Congress to Adopt a Strong Revenue-based Safety Net Program in the 2008 Farm Bill
(1-8-08)
With the House of Representatives reconvening Jan. 15 and the Senate following suit on Jan. 22, the National Corn Growers Association is hopeful the 2008 Farm Bill will provide farmers with better targeted and more reliable protection against crop losses. NCGA urges Congress to address producers’ risk management needs and commodity prices with an optional revenue-based safety program when the farm bill goes to the House and Senate conference committee.
